Output 86974e063f80d76e0561563aa56289aa64a63c86252100ae58a62d81b4bbadef:1

value
25925900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6e27cd6e32ccc2134b1a128ff74144881b6a1b OP_EQUAL
address
MDKQ4V5nmigyai5N2zfhfBVLSPkZuBFPrr
transaction
86974e063f80d76e0561563aa56289aa64a63c86252100ae58a62d81b4bbadef
spent
true